Is a Gold IRA Worth It? Understanding the Risks and Rewards

A Gold Individual Retirement Account (IRA) check here presents a unique opportunity for investors seeking to diversify their portfolios against economic uncertainty. However, it's crucial to thoroughly consider both the potential rewards and the inherent risks before investing your hard-earned savings.

One of the most attractive attributes of a Gold IRA is its potential for preservation during times of economic uncertainty. Gold has historically functioned as a store of value, offering some degree of stability when other assets may decline.

Additionally, a Gold IRA can enhance the diversification of your retirement plan, potentially mitigating overall exposure. Nevertheless, it's important to understand that gold is not without its risks. Its value can be influenced by a variety of elements, including global economic conditions, interest rates, and investor perception.

Before investing in a Gold IRA, it's essential to perform thorough research and engage a qualified financial advisor. They can help you evaluate if a Gold IRA is appropriate with your investment objectives and risk capacity. Remember, investing in any asset class, including gold, involves inherent risks, and past performance is not always indicative of future results.
